How early should I arrive at the airport?
Ugh, airports. Two hours usually does it for domestic flights. Checked a bag at JFK (23 June) and it was a breeze. But holiday travel? Nightmare. Three hours, minimum. Thanksgiving last year (24 November), I got to LaGuardia two hours early and barely made my flight. Security line was insane.
Domestic flights: Arrive 2-3 hours prior to departure.
This covers check-in, baggage, and security. Once, at LAX (12 April, $18 for a terrible sandwich), I had to sprint to the gate because the security took forever. Better safe than sorry.
